Objective diagnosis of combat PTSD and effective rehabilitation of war veterans is a current multifaceted problem with particularly high social costs. This review aims to evaluate the potential of virtual reality technique used as exposure therapy tool (VRET) to rehabilitate combat veterans and service members with PTSD. The review was written following the guidelines of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A). The final analysis includes 75 articles published in 2017-2022. VRET therapeutic effect mechanisms were examined along with protocols and scenarios of VRET combined with other interventions influencing PTSD treatment like pharmacotherapy, motion-assisted multi-modular memory desensitization and reconsolidation (3MDR), transcranial magnetic stimulation. The necessity is substantiated of psychophysiological measurements for objectification of PTSD clinical criteria and its dynamics during treatment. It was shown that inclusion of VRET to the package of PTSD rehabilitation interventions positively affects the results due to the enhanced effect of presence and greater experience personalization. PAAT segmentation was performed using 3D Slicer application followed by extraction of 93 radiomic features. At the end of the follow-up period, patients were divided into 2 groups depending on the presence or absence of AF recurrence.</p><p><strong>Results: </strong>12 months of follow-up after catheter ablation, postablation AF recurrence was reported in 19 out of 43 patients. Of 93 extracted radiomic features of PAAT, statistically significant differences were observed for 3 features of the Gray Level Size Zone matrix. The participants were divided into three groups: group 1 underwent classic aortic arch reconstruction using hemiarch technique or total reconstruction of the aortic arch with a multiple-branch prosthesis (n=121); group 2 was subjected to the hemiarch technique and implantation of bare-metal (uncoated) stents (n=55); in group 3, the \"frozen elephant trunk\" correction technique was used (n=37). The diagnosis of all patients included into the study was preoperatively confirmed by ultrasound and tomographic examination. The animals were divided into 7 experimental groups with complete transection of the sciatic nerve on the right side at the mid-third level of the thigh. The ends of the transected nerve were pulled apart, inserted into a silicon conduit, and secured to the epineurium. The conduit of group 1 (control) was filled with a saline solution; in group 2, it was filled with an autologous omental adipose tissue with saline solution. Intravital labeling of the omental adipose tissue with the lipophilic PKH 26 dye (in group 3) was used for the first time to find out whether the omental cells were involved in formation of the regenerating nerve. Diastasis in groups 1-3 was 5 mm, the postoperative period was 14 weeks. The dynamics of the omental adipose tissue changes in groups 4-7 was assessed by placing the omental tissues into the conduit covering 2 mm of diastasis.
